Landscape drainage repair services focus on fixing issues related to water movement and accumulation in outdoor spaces. These services typically involve assessing existing drainage systems, identifying problem areas, and implementing solutions such as installing or repairing drainage pipes, improving grading, or adding drainage features like French drains or swales. The goal is to ensure water flows away from structures and landscaped areas, preventing standing water and excess moisture that can cause damage or erosion. Proper drainage repair helps maintain the integrity of the landscape while reducing potential water-related problems.
Problems addressed by landscape drainage repair include water pooling, erosion, soil instability, and damage to foundations or landscaping features. Excess water can lead to muddy or soggy lawns, compromised plant health, and even structural issues if water seeps into basements or crawl spaces. Repair services aim to eliminate these issues by re-routing water, improving surface grading, or installing new drainage systems that work effectively with the property's topography. These solutions are especially important in areas prone to heavy rainfall or poor natural drainage, ensuring outdoor spaces remain functional and safe.

The overview below groups typical Landscape Drainage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pfafftown,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The typical cost for landscape drainage repair ranges from $1,000 to $4,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the area involved. For example, fixing a small section of damaged piping may cost around $1,200, while extensive repairs could reach $3,500 or more.
Installation Expenses - Installing new drainage systems generally costs between $2,500 and $7,000, influenced by the size and complexity of the project. A basic French drain installation in Pfafftown might be around $3,000, whereas more elaborate drainage solutions can exceed $6,500.
Material Costs - Material expenses for landscape drainage repairs typically range from $300 to $1,500, depending on the type and quality of materials used. For instance, high-grade perforated pipes and gravel may push costs toward the upper end of this range.
Additional Fees - Extra costs such as permits or site prep can add $200 to $800 to the overall expense. These fees vary based on local regulations and the specific requirements of the drainage repair project in Pfafftown area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es drainage problems in landscapes? Drainage issues can result from poor soil absorption, compacted ground, or improper grading, leading to water pooling or erosion.
How can landscape drainage be repaired? Repairs typically involve installing or adjusting drainage systems such as French drains, grading, or drainage pipes to redirect water away from problem areas.
What signs indicate a need for drainage repair? Signs include persistent pooling of water, erosion, soggy areas, or water runoff near foundations or walkways.
Are there different types of drainage solutions available? Yes, options include surface drains, French drains, dry wells, and grading adjustments, depending on the specific landscape needs.
